The Value of Vitex Agnus - castus

Historical and Medicinal Significance Vitex Agnus - castus has a rich history in traditional medicine systems around the world. In ancient Greece, it was used as a remedy for various gynecological problems. The extract is believed to have an impact on the hormonal balance in the body, particularly in relation to the female reproductive system. It is often used to regulate menstrual cycles, relieve premenstrual syndrome (PMS) symptoms, and may also play a role in promoting fertility. For example, some women with irregular menstrual cycles have reported positive changes after using Vitex Agnus - castus extract.

Modern Research and Applications In modern times, scientific research has been conducted to explore the potential mechanisms behind the effects of Vitex Agnus - castus. Studies have suggested that it may interact with the hypothalamic - pituitary - ovarian axis, which is crucial for hormonal regulation. This has led to its increasing use in the form of dietary supplements and herbal remedies. As a result, the demand for high - quality Vitex Agnus - castus extract has been on the rise.

Economic Factors in Production

Cost of Raw Materials

The cost of raw materials is a significant factor in determining the overall cost of Vitex Agnus - castus extract. The price can vary depending on several aspects:

  • Cultivation Location: Different regions have different costs associated with growing Vitex Agnus - castus. For instance, in some areas with favorable climates and abundant land, the cost of cultivation may be relatively low. In contrast, regions with harsher environmental conditions or limited arable land may incur higher costs. For example, in certain European countries where land is scarce and labor costs are high, the cost of growing Vitex Agnus - castus may be elevated compared to regions in Asia or Africa where large areas of land are available for cultivation.
  • Scale of Farming: Large - scale farming operations often have the advantage of economies of scale. When farmers cultivate Vitex Agnus - castus on a large scale, they can reduce the cost per unit of raw material. This is because they can spread fixed costs, such as the cost of land preparation, irrigation systems, and machinery, over a larger quantity of produce. For example, a large - scale farm in India may be able to produce Vitex Agnus - castus at a lower cost per kilogram compared to a small - scale grower in a developed country.

Production Processes

The production processes involved in obtaining Vitex Agnus - castus extract also impact the cost. These processes include harvesting, drying, and extraction.

  • Harvesting: The timing and method of harvesting can affect the quality and quantity of the raw material. If the harvesting is done at the optimal time, the yield and quality of the berries will be better, which can ultimately lead to a more cost - effective production process. For example, harvesting too early or too late may result in lower yields or poorer quality berries, increasing the cost per unit of extract.
  • Drying: Proper drying of the harvested berries is crucial. If not dried correctly, the berries may spoil or lose some of their active components. The cost of drying can vary depending on the drying method used. For example, using natural sunlight for drying may be less expensive than using sophisticated drying equipment, but it may also be more time - consuming and less reliable in terms of quality control.
  • Extraction: Different extraction methods can have different costs. Solvent extraction, for example, may require the purchase of solvents and specialized equipment, which adds to the cost. However, more advanced extraction methods may also result in a higher - quality extract with a higher concentration of active ingredients.

Reliable Suppliers

Transparency in Sourcing

A reliable supplier of Vitex Agnus - castus extract should be highly transparent about their sourcing. This means that they should be able to clearly communicate where they obtain their raw materials.

  • Origin of Raw Materials: Suppliers should disclose the origin of the Vitex Agnus - castus berries. Knowing the origin helps in assessing the quality and potential contaminants. For example, if the berries are sourced from an area with a history of pesticide overuse, there may be a higher risk of chemical residues in the extract. A trustworthy supplier will ensure that their raw materials come from clean and sustainable sources.
  • Supplier - Grower Relationships: Transparency also extends to the relationship between the supplier and the growers. A good supplier will have a stable and ethical relationship with the farmers. This may include fair trade practices, such as paying a reasonable price to the growers and providing support in terms of agricultural knowledge and sustainable farming techniques.

Transparency in Extraction and Manufacturing

In addition to sourcing, a reliable supplier should be open about their extraction and manufacturing processes.

  • Extraction Methods: Suppliers should disclose the extraction method used to obtain the Vitex Agnus - castus extract. This is important because different extraction methods can result in different quality and purity of the extract. For example, a supplier using a supercritical CO2 extraction method may be able to produce a higher - quality, more pure extract compared to one using a less - advanced solvent extraction method.
  • Quality Control: A trustworthy supplier will have a strict quality control system in place. They should be able to provide information about the tests they conduct on the extract, such as tests for purity, potency, and the presence of contaminants. This ensures that the customers receive a consistent and high - quality product.

Direct Communication with Suppliers

Direct communication with suppliers is essential for gaining insights into their operations.

  • Asking the Right Questions: When communicating with suppliers, it is important to ask relevant questions. For example, one can inquire about their production capacity, how they handle fluctuations in raw material availability, and what measures they take to ensure product consistency. This information can help in evaluating the reliability of the supplier.
  • Visiting the Supplier (if possible): If feasible, visiting the supplier's facilities can provide a more in - depth understanding of their operations. This allows for a first - hand look at their production processes, quality control measures, and the overall working environment. It can also help in establishing a more personal and trusting relationship with the supplier.

International Trade Regulations

Import/Export Duties

International trade regulations, such as import/export duties, can significantly affect the availability and cost of Vitex Agnus - castus extract.

  • Import Duties: When importing Vitex Agnus - castus extract from one country to another, import duties may be imposed. These duties can increase the cost of the extract for the importer. For example, a high import duty in a particular country may make it less economically viable to import the extract from a foreign supplier. This may lead to a search for local suppliers or alternative products.
  • Export Duties: Some countries may also impose export duties on Vitex Agnus - castus or its raw materials. This can affect the price at which suppliers in those countries can offer their products in the international market. For example, if a major exporting country imposes a high export duty, it may reduce the competitiveness of their Vitex Agnus - castus extract in the global market.

Quality Standards

Different countries may have different quality standards for Vitex Agnus - castus extract.

  • Regulatory Requirements: Some countries may have strict regulatory requirements regarding the purity, potency, and safety of the extract. Suppliers need to comply with these requirements in order to enter the market. For example, in the European Union, herbal products are subject to specific regulations that ensure their quality and safety. This may require additional testing and documentation for suppliers, which can increase the cost of production and ultimately the price of the extract.
  • Certifications: Certain certifications, such as organic certifications or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) certifications, may be required in some markets. Obtaining these certifications can be costly for suppliers but can also enhance their credibility and competitiveness. For example, a supplier with an organic certification may be able to command a higher price for their Vitex Agnus - castus extract in markets where consumers are willing to pay a premium for organic products.

Future Developments

New Agricultural Techniques

The use of new agricultural techniques holds great potential for the production of Vitex Agnus - castus.

  • Genetic Improvement: Genetic research may lead to the development of improved varieties of Vitex Agnus - castus. These new varieties could have higher yields, better resistance to pests and diseases, or enhanced content of active ingredients. For example, through genetic modification or selective breeding, scientists may be able to create a variety of Vitex Agnus - castus that produces more berries with a higher concentration of the beneficial compounds.
  • Precision Agriculture: Precision agriculture techniques, such as the use of satellite imagery, drones, and sensors, can optimize the cultivation of Vitex Agnus - castus. These techniques can help in monitoring soil conditions, water requirements, and plant health more accurately. By providing more precise information, farmers can make better - informed decisions about irrigation, fertilization, and pest control, leading to increased yields and cost savings.

Advanced Extraction and Processing Technologies

The development of advanced extraction and processing technologies can also impact the future of Vitex Agnus - castus extract production.

  • Green Extraction Technologies: There is a growing trend towards the use of green extraction technologies, such as supercritical fluid extraction and microwave - assisted extraction. These methods are more environmentally friendly and can often produce higher - quality extracts. For example, supercritical CO2 extraction can extract the active ingredients from Vitex Agnus - castus without leaving behind harmful residues, and it can also preserve the integrity of the compounds better than traditional solvent extraction methods.
  • Value - Added Processing: In addition to extraction, value - added processing of Vitex Agnus - castus extract can increase its marketability. This may include the development of encapsulated forms of the extract for better stability and bioavailability, or the creation of combination products with other complementary herbs or nutrients. For example, a product that combines Vitex Agnus - castus extract with Vitamin B6 and magnesium may be more effective in relieving PMS symptoms and could attract a wider customer base.
